Ranking for "near me" searches needs optimizing local listings, unbranded keywords, evaluations, and visual material throughout search, maps, social, and AI platforms to capture high-intent local traffic. "Near me" searches have transformed how customers find local organizations. According to the, 83% of consumers still use online search engine like Google or Bing to discover local businessesbut 73% likewise find them on social media, and nearly 20% now turn to AI assistants such as ChatGPT or Gemini.
Over the past decade, searches containing "near me" have blown up. They peaked in July 2021 with an interest score of 100 and stay high today, showing that local intent is here to remain. Searches like "restaurants near me", "tasks near me", and "stores near me" continue to control. The 2025 CBI exposed a crucial shift42% of consumers now use unbranded, generic terms such as "coffee near me" instead of brand name names.
The chart below depicts the "near me" search term in the United States over the previous 9 years. Mobile phones remain the leading motorist of "near me" searches, but AI is quickly joining the mix. Almost one in 5 consumers now use AI tools to find suggestions, with Gen Z leading the pattern.
Consistency across these channels is what wins the click (and the see). Leading Associated "Near Me" Queries Google ranks regional outcomes based upon 3 primary aspects: Significance: How well your listing matches what users are looking for Proximity: Distance from the searcher's current location Prominence: How widely known and well-reviewed your company is across the web The 2025 CBI found that precision, convenience, and customer feedback are now the top 3 elements affecting where customers choose to check out.
Your Google Service Profile (GBP) is your digital shop. Organizations that rank in Google's regional 3-pack make 126% more traffic and 93% more actions than those ranked listed below. To optimize your GBP: Keep your Name, Address, and Phone constant. Update hours, specifically around vacations or events. Add photos, videos, and qualities (e.g., ease of access, amenities).
Enable features like mobile ordering, reservations, or scheduling to convert searchers immediately. For multi-location brand names, regional landing pages are vital for constructing significance. Each page needs to include: City-specific keywords (e.g., "emergency situation oral care in Austin") SEO-friendly URLs and meta descriptions Client reviews and user-generated material Clear calls-to-action and mobile-first style highlights optimizing for unbranded keywords to capture the 63% of regional searches that do not consist of brand.
Pro suggestion: Link these area pages to associated blog site content using keyword-rich anchor text to enhance your internal SEO structure. 91% of customers check out reviews before checking out a regional organization, and 65% are most likely to pick a service that reacts. To develop proof that drives trust: Motivate satisfied customers to leave evaluations.
Include fresh, high-quality pictures and videos frequently. As explains, organizations that regularly upgrade photo material see more powerful performance in regional resultsand higher conversion rates. Generative AI has altered how people search. Your material now needs to carry out in both traditional search and AI-driven suggestions. Here's how: Write in natural, conversational language that addresses real concerns.
Usage schema markup for structured information like openingHours and priceRange. Rich, structured material helps your brand name appear when consumers ask AI tools for the "finest [service] near me." What You Need to Learn about "Near Me" Searches "Near me" SEO enables organizations to get in front of people at the choice phase of the consumer journey.
Usually, you'll benefit from regional SEO "near me" optimization if you own any type of business with a brick-and-mortar place that consumers will go to. A few examples consist of retail, restaurants, home entertainment, hotels, medspas, and field service companies like a/c, plumbers, or electrical contractors. These organizations all target audiences that are close by.
